About This Item

New York, 1961. unbound. 1 page on personal stationery, 7 x 6 inches, New York, October 21, 1961, in part: "There is not satisfactory progress in heading off Leukemia...you may write Dr. Sidney Farben who makes the most encouraging study about Leukemia in childhood..." Accompanied by the original handwritten, postmarked envelope. One horizontal fold; tiny crease in the upper right corner. Very good(+) condition.<br/> <br/> Hungarian-American pediatrician who gained international renown for the Schick test which determined an individual's susceptibility to diphtheria, virtually eliminating the dreaded disease.<br/> <br/>
